The visitation for Jacqueline “Jackie” Smith will be 5:007:00 p.m. Wednesday, May 29, 2024 at Olson Funeral Chapel in Britton. A graveside service will be at 11:00 a.m. Thursday, May 30, 2024 at the Britton Cemetery. Following the graveside service there will be a time for fellowship and a lunch at the Britton Event Center.

David, Dawn and Becky welcomed Jacqueline DeNeal (Jackie) into their family February 13, 1988. Her biggest joy was becoming a big sister to her brothers, Alex and Logan. Family and friends were everything to Jackie.

Jackie attended Britton Helca Schools and was confirmed in the United Methodist Church in Britton.

Growing up, Jackie spent a lot of time at Wheatcrest Hills spreading her infectious laugh with the residents. She could not wait until she turned 16 to “bust through those doors” to become a CNA. She treated the residents as her own with love and respect. When she moved to Roslyn, SD for a few years she shared her smile and laugh with the residents there. She then moved to Amherst, SD and met the love of her life, Evan Robinson. They then moved to Sayre, OK where she worked various jobs. When Evan’s grandmother’s health declined they moved to Rapid City to take care of her. After Grandma passed she began working as an insurance associate for Assurant until the time of her death.

Jackie’s family grew when she became Aunty Jackie to two special little ones, twins Nirvana and Dexter. They were her babies.

Jackie’s heart was always open to new friends. She had a smile and laugh that could brighten anyone’s day. Jackie was not afraid to go to new places, try new things. She never met a stranger. Jackie showed up and the fun began.

Jackie manicured her fingernails daily with colors and decorations for different occasions. She had the patience to do diamond painting and other crafts.

Jackie passed away at her home in Rapid City May 7, 2024. She was only 36 years young.

Grateful for sharing her life are her fiancé, Evan Robinson; two special little ones, Nirvana and Dexter; her parents, David and Dawn; her sister, Becky (Aaron) Wade; her brother, Logan; the Robinson family; many Aunts, Uncles and cousins.

Preceding her in death is her brother, Alex; her maternal grandparents, Neil and Edythe Stiegelmeier; her parental grandparents, Jack and Margie Smith.
